ORDER
AND NOW, this 24th day of January, 2014, for the
reasons set forth in the accompanying Memorandum, it is hereby
ORDERED that:
(1)
the motion of intervenors for reasonable counsel
fees and costs is GRANTED;
(2)
the defendant Lincoln on Locust, L.P. and its
counsel, O'Connor Kimball LLP, are obligated, jointly and
severally, to pay the intervenors Benzion "Sam" Faibish and
Yehuda Olewski, $23,497.20 in reasonable counsel fees and costs
in connection with the emergency motion of intervenors to enforce
Stipulated Order and for mandatory injunctive relief as a result
of its violation of the court's pretrial Stipulated Order dated
August 13, 2013; and
(3)
such payment shall be made within thirty days of
this Order.
